AFCON 2025: Algeria, Cameroon, Ivory Coast, Burkina chase vital wins today

The group stage of AFCON 2025 enters a decisive phase today as eight teams face off in four crucial Matchday 2 fixtures in Morocco. Heavyweights Algeria, Burkina Faso, Côte d’Ivoire and Cameroon are all in action with qualification places on the line.​ The tournament, which runs from December 21, 2025 to January 18, 2026, has already delivered drama. Nigeria sealed a Round of 16 spot on Saturday after a 3–2 win over Tunisia in a five goal thriller.​ Saturday’s games in Groups C and D were keenly contested. Ndidi: Super Eagles motivated by painful 2021 AFCON loss to Tunisia

Nigeria captain Wilfred Ndidi says the Super Eagles will use the memory of their shock defeat to Tunisia at the 2021 Africa Cup of Nations as motivation when the two sides meet again in the group stage on Friday. Five years ago, Nigeria entered the round-of-16 clash as overwhelming favourites after a flawless group campaign that included a win over seven-time champions Egypt. Tunisia, by contrast, scraped through as one of the best third-placed teams. However, the Carthage Eagles stunned Nigeria with a 1-0 victory, capitalising on a defensive error and a red card shown to Alex Iwobi. AFCON 2025 Nacional hero Osinachi backs Super Eagles for title

FIFA U 17 World Cup winner Christian Ebere Osinachi has backed the Super Eagles to win their fourth Africa Cup of Nations title at AFCON 2025 in Morocco. The 27 year old forward recently became a hero for Uruguay’s Club Nacional after scoring a 114th minute winner to secure the club’s 50th league title against rivals Atlético Peñarol.​ Nigeria have won AFCON three times in 1980, 1994 and 2013 and are chasing a first continental title in 12 years after finishing as runners up at the last edition in Cote d’Ivoire. Aiyegbeni tells Super Eagles to prepare for tougher AFCON tests

Former Super Eagles striker Yakubu Aiyegbeni has urged Nigeria to prepare for tougher tests at the Africa Cup of Nations despite their 2–1 opening win over Tanzania.​ He praised Victor Osimhen’s hard work and movement but noted that the Galatasaray forward was unlucky not to score, even though he consistently found good positions in front of goal.​ Aiyegbeni highlighted the team’s attacking play in Fez, where Nigeria built moves through the flanks and quick combinations around the box. He said Alex Iwobi controlled key moments, linking well with Samuel Chukwueze and Ademola Lookman to create chances for Osimhen.​ He pointed to the number of opportunities created as proof that the system around the striker is working. Super Eagles squad profiled for AFCON Morocco 2025

Nigeria’s Super Eagles head into AFCON Morocco 2025 with a blend of experienced internationals and hungry newcomers determined to end the country’s 12 year wait for a fourth continental title. Coach Eric Sekou Chelle’s squad will open their Group C campaign against Tanzania at the Complexe Sportif de Fès, where they also face Tunisia and Uganda in the group phase.​ In goal, Stanley Nwabali retains his status as numero uno after his outstanding displays at AFCON 2023, backed by experienced Francis Uzoho and newcomer Amas Obasogie, who represents the future of the position. Super Eagles receive Tinubu’s national honours, housing and land rewards

Super Eagles players who finished as runners up at the 2023 Africa Cup of Nations have officially received their national honours certificates along with title documents for houses and land promised by President Bola Ahmed Tinubu. The presentation was held on December 22, 2025, at the team’s hotel in Fez, Morocco, ahead of the start of their new AFCON qualifying campaign.​ President Tinubu announced the rewards after Nigeria’s impressive run at AFCON 2023 in Côte d’Ivoire, where the team reached the final earlier in 2024. The package included national honours, housing allocations in Abuja or Lagos and land grants in Abuja for squad members and officials.​ The brief ceremony was led by National Sports Commission chairman Shehu Dikko and attended by top government and sports officials. Nigeria vs Tanzania AFCON 2025 match preview

Nigeria begin their quest for a fourth Africa Cup of Nations title on Tuesday when they face Tanzania in their opening Group C match at AFCON 2025. The game will be played at the Fez Stadium in Fez, Morocco, with kick off scheduled for 6.30 p.m. Nigerian time.​ The Super Eagles come into the tournament as one of the favourites after reaching the final of the last edition and topping their qualifying group. Coach Eric Chelle has said a strong start is vital and admitted there is heavy pressure, as Nigerians expect the team to compete for the trophy.​ Nigeria are expected to line up with a powerful attack led by Victor Osimhen, who has been passed fit for the match. AFCON 2025 Super Eagles chase redemption in Morocco​

The Super Eagles head to the 2025 Africa Cup of Nations in Morocco caught between harsh recent realities and a powerful desire for redemption. Back to back World Cup qualification failures, administrative problems and questions over preparation have lowered expectations, even as Nigeria still boasts one of Africa’s most gifted squads.​ Nigeria’s AFCON record remains imposing, with three titles, seven final appearances and a long history of producing elite talent. AFCON 2025 is seen as a chance to reset the country’s football story and restore belief after years of frustration.​ Former captain John Obi Mikel has strongly criticised Nigeria’s build up, describing reports of unpaid wages to head coach Eric Chelle as unacceptable and embarrassing. Carter Efe sets new African Twitch streaming records

Content creator Carter Efe has become Africa’s most followed streamer on Twitch, after his recent high profile livestream with Afrobeats superstar Davido. He has now surpassed fellow comedian Shank Comics, crossing more than 406,000 followers on the platform.​ The collaboration with Davido triggered a major spike in viewership and followers for Efe. Their joint livestream peaked at about 83,000 viewers, setting a new record for the most watched Twitch stream from Africa.​ Carter Efe also became the first African streamer to pass 20,000 subscribers on Twitch. The numbers underline his rapid rise as one of the continent’s leading digital entertainers.​ Davido’s appearance played a central role in the stream’s success. Osimhen arrival lifts Super Eagles AFCON camp in Cairo

The Super Eagles camp in Cairo is now at full strength following the arrival of star striker Victor Osimhen on Wednesday night, as Nigeria intensifies preparations for the 35th Africa Cup of Nations in Morocco. Osimhen arrived at about 9:45 p.m. Nigerian time, completing the list of 28 invited players for the tournament, which runs from 21 December 2025 to 18 January 2026. Super Eagles media officer Promise Efoghe confirmed Osimhen’s arrival and described it as a major morale boost for the team. He said that with all players now in camp, the entire squad can focus fully on final preparations and a common objective at AFCON. The team opened camp on Sunday, 14 December, at the Renaissance Hotels in Cairo, with all coaches and backroom staff already on ground.
